The job market in Taunton, Massachusetts

With data compiled from reliable public sources and government organizations like the Bureau of Labor Statistics and the U.S. Census Bureau, Joblift provides you with essential insights to help you in your job search in Taunton, MA.

In Taunton, a diverse range of industries contribute to the city's economic landscape. Health care plays a significant role in providing ample job opportunities for residents, while retail businesses cater to the shopping needs of locals and visitors alike. The manufacturing sector supports the production of goods, and educational institutions contribute to the overall development of the community. Lastly, the hospitality industry ensures that tourists and travelers are well taken care of during their stay. This combination of industries offers a stable foundation for those seeking employment opportunities within the city.

When considering employment prospects in the city, it is essential to examine various factors that contribute to its job market's unique characteristics. The city is known for offering an average salary of $64,290, which is 7.13% below the national average. However, a noteworthy point is that approximately 45% of the population has insurance coverage provided by their employer. This aspect can be quite appealing to potential job seekers.

An important consideration when evaluating this city as a possible career destination is its cost of living index. With a value of 10.0% above the national median, it indicates that the city has a slightly higher-than-average cost of living. Despite this, many individuals may still find it attractive due to the availability and quality of certain amenities and services.
